The Early Days: N.E.R.D and Collaborative Beginnings
Pharrell’s musical journey began with the formation of the band N.E.R.D (No-one Ever Really Dies) alongside childhood friend Chad Hugo. The group emerged in the late 1990s, blending elements of hip-hop, rock, and electronic music to create a unique sound that resonated with a diverse audience. Albums like “In Search Of…” (2001) and “Fly or Die” (2008) showcased Pharrell’s versatility as a songwriter and producer, setting the stage for his solo career.
His collaborative spirit extended beyond N.E.R.D, working with a wide array of artists including Jay-Z, Daft Punk, and Justin Timberlake. Pharrell’s production skills and ability to blend genres seamlessly have made him one of the most sought-after producers in the industry. His work on Timberlake’s album “FutureSex/LoveSounds” (2006), which included the hit single “SexyBack,” further cemented his reputation as a creative force.
